Abstract

The application discloses a cable window frame, which comprises at least one connecting frame, a first side frame and a second side frame located at two side ends, and the at least one connecting frame is detachably connected with the first side frame and the second side frame, and the first side frame and the connecting frame are detachably connected, and the second side frame and the connecting frame are detachably connected, and the at least one connecting frame, the first side frame and the second side frame are connected to form the cable window frame, and the cable window frame comprises a plurality of placing spaces used for placing cable panels, and the number of the connecting frames, the first side frame and the second side frame can be selected according to the number of the placing spaces of the cable panels required, so that the number of the placing spaces of the cable panels can be satisfied.

Claims

1. A cable window frame, characterized in that, It includes at least one connecting frame and a first border and a second border located at both ends. When there are multiple connecting frames, the multiple connecting frames are detachably connected. The first border and the connecting frame are detachably connected, and the second border and the connecting frame are detachably connected. At least one connecting frame, the first border, and the second border are connected to form a cable window frame. The cable window frame includes multiple placement spaces for placing cable panels.

2. The cable window frame according to claim 1, characterized in that, The first frame includes a first crossbar located at the top and bottom, a first side bar connected to the side portion of the first crossbar at the top and bottom, and at least one first graft located between the first crossbar at the top and bottom and connected to the side portion of the first side bar.

3. The cable window frame according to claim 2, characterized in that, The free end of the first crossbar is provided with a through hole and a frame groove, and the free end of the first crossbar is also provided with a first U-shaped groove, and the free end of the first graft is provided with a first strip groove.

4. The cable window frame according to claim 1, characterized in that, The second frame includes a second crossbar located at the top and bottom respectively, a second side bar connected to the side portion of the second crossbar at the top and bottom, and at least one second graft located between the second crossbar at the top and bottom and connected to the side portion of the second side bar.

5. The cable window frame according to claim 4, characterized in that, The free end of the second crossbar has a through hole, a frame protrusion is provided on the free end of the second crossbar, a first U-shaped protrusion is also provided on the free end of the second crossbar, and a first strip-shaped protrusion is provided on the free end of the second graft.

6. The cable window frame according to claim 1, characterized in that, The connecting frame includes a third crossbar located at the top and bottom respectively, a third side bar connected to the middle of the third crossbar at the top and bottom, and at least two third grafts located between the third crossbars at the top and bottom and connected to the side of the third side bar.

7. The cable window frame according to claim 6, characterized in that, The third crossbar has through holes at both ends. A connecting frame protrusion is provided on one end of the third crossbar, and a connecting frame groove corresponding to the connecting frame protrusion is provided on the other end of the third crossbar. A second U-shaped protrusion is provided on one end of the third crossbar, and a second U-shaped groove corresponding to the second U-shaped protrusion is provided on the other end of the third crossbar. A second strip-shaped protrusion is provided on the free end of the third graft on one side of the third crossbar, and a second strip-shaped groove is provided on the free end of the third graft on the other side of the third crossbar.

8. The cable window frame according to claim 1, characterized in that, A blocking strip is provided in the area of ​​the placement space enclosed by the connecting frame, the first border, and the second border, and the blocking strip is used to restrict the movement of the cable panel.

9. The cable window frame according to claim 8, characterized in that, Strip-shaped partitions for fixing the cable panel are provided on the sides of the first side bar, the second side bar, and the third side bar in the area enclosing the placement space.

10. The cable window frame according to claim 9, characterized in that, The cable panel is elastic, and the strip-shaped crimp cable panel is elastic.
